I want to start taking driving lessons. What should I do first?

To begin taking lessons on a public road, you must have a valid Provisional Licence. If you don't already have one, you can apply quickly and easily online by clicking HERE. You can also apply for your licence by post by completing a D1 application form, available from most Post Offices.
How old do I need to be to learn to drive?

The minimum legal age at which you can drive a car on the public roads is currently 17. If you are disabled and in receipt of mobility allowance, the minimum legal age is 16.
How many lessons will I need?

We recommend a minimum of 1 lesson of 1.5 hours duration per week, but how often you have lessons, and their duration, is entirely your choice. The more time you spend in the car however, the quicker you will learn and the more money you will save.
As a rough guide, an average pupil taking 1 hour per week would take approximately 8 months to 1 year to learn to drive.
I am very nervous about learning to drive. What can you do to help me?

I have been teaching people to drive for over 16 years now, and have come across many nervous students in my time. The first thing that you should realise is that being nervous is completely normal.
You are considering learning a new skill, and one, which for most people is not a natural one.
I do not use any 'magical training formulas' in my instruction, quite simply because they do not exist. What you will receive is plenty of patience, understanding and good communication, helping you to build confidence in a safe and friendly environment.
